How does not removing all of the spacers for shrinkage effect your log?. We have large vertical splits in the logs we did not take the spacers out of.

I am not exactly sure what spacers you are talking about, but they should not be removed.  Also, do not fill the checks (cracks) in the logs as this can cause log rot over time.  The caulk will pull away from the wood over time and allow still water down into the check but now that it is filled it will not dry out and start rot.
